İçerik
- Tarayıcı Tabanlı Oyunlarda Geliştirme ve Güvenlik İpuçları
- Geliştirme Stratejileri
- Oyun Motoru Seçimi
- Performans Optimizasyonu
- Kullanıcı Deneyimi Odaklı Tasarım
- Güvenlik İpuçları
Tarayıcı Tabanlı Oyun Geliştirme ve Güvenlik İçin En Etkili Stratejiler
Günümüz dijital dünyasında, çevrimiçi eğlenceler önemli bir yer edinmiştir. Bu alan, kullanıcıların etkileşimde bulunabileceği ve eğlenebileceği yenilikçi platformlar sunmaktadır. Ancak, bu platformların oluşturulması ve sürdürülebilirliği, belirli zorluklarla birlikte gelir.
Yaratıcı süreçler, yalnızca teknik bilgi gerektirmekle kalmaz; aynı zamanda bu sürecin güvenliğini sağlamak da kritik bir öneme sahiptir. Etkili ve güvenilir sistemler geliştirmek, kullanıcı deneyimini iyileştirmenin yanı sıra, potansiyel tehditlere karşı da koruma sağlar.
Bu yazıda, başarılı bir çevrimiçi platform oluşturmanın yollarını ve karşılaşabileceğiniz riskleri minimize etmenin yöntemlerini keşfedeceğiz. Her adımda, hem yenilikçi hem de güvenli bir yaklaşım benimsemek için gerekli olan bilgileri derinlemesine inceleyeceğiz.
Tarayıcı Tabanlı Oyunlarda Geliştirme ve Güvenlik İpuçları
Modern çevrimiçi platformlarda kullanıcı deneyimini artırmak ve olası tehditleri en aza indirmek için önemli unsurlar bulunmaktadır. Bu bağlamda, geliştiricilerin dikkate alması gereken birkaç temel prensip öne çıkmaktadır. Doğru yaklaşım, hem oyuncuların memnuniyetini sağlarken hem de projelerin sürdürülebilirliğini artırmaktadır.
Öncelikle, güvenilir kodlama uygulamalarına yönelmek, potansiyel açıkların kapatılmasında kritik bir rol oynamaktadır. Kullanılan kütüphanelerin güncel olması, saldırılara karşı dayanıklılığı artırırken, test süreçlerinin düzenli yapılması da ihmal edilmemelidir. Bununla birlikte, kullanıcı verilerinin korunması, her projede öncelik taşımalıdır.
İletişim protokollerinin güvenliği, veri alışverişinin sağlıklı bir şekilde gerçekleşmesi için şarttır. Şifreleme tekniklerinin kullanılması, bilgilerin üçüncü şahıslar tarafından erişilmesini engelleyecektir. Aynı zamanda, oyuncuların geri bildirimleri, geliştiricilerin süreçlerini iyileştirmesine yardımcı olur.
Son olarak, her zaman güncel kalmak ve en son gelişmeleri takip etmek, başarılı bir yol haritasının temelini oluşturur. Eğitim ve bilgi paylaşımı, ekiplerin yetkinliğini artırarak, daha sağlam projelerin ortaya çıkmasına katkı sağlar.
Geliştirme Stratejileri
Bir projeyi hayata geçirmek için kullanılan yöntemler, başarılı sonuçlar elde etmek açısından kritik öneme sahiptir. Bu süreçte dikkat edilmesi gereken unsurlar, hem performansı artıracak hem de kullanıcı deneyimini geliştirecek şekilde yapılandırılmalıdır.
Planlama aşaması, projenin temellerini atar. Hedef kitle belirlenmeli ve onların ihtiyaçları doğrultusunda bir yol haritası çizilmelidir. Prototip geliştirme süreci, fikirlerin somut hale gelmesini sağlayarak erken aşamada geri bildirim alınmasına olanak tanır.
Ayrıca, modüler yapı oluşturmak, kodun yeniden kullanılabilirliğini artırır ve bakım süreçlerini kolaylaştırır. Test süreçleri ise hataları minimize ederek, son üründe daha yüksek bir kalite standartı sağlar.
Son olarak, topluluk geri bildirimleri almak, sürekli gelişim için kritik bir adımdır. Kullanıcıların deneyimlerini değerlendirmek, gelecekteki iyileştirmeler için yol gösterici olacaktır.
Oyun Motoru Seçimi
Her projenin başarısı, kullanılan altyapının kalitesine bağlıdır. Doğru yazılım aracı, geliştiricilerin hayal ettikleri deneyimi yaratmalarına yardımcı olurken, performans ve uyumluluk gibi kritik unsurları da göz önünde bulundurmalıdır.
Piyasa, çeşitli motorlar sunarak, farklı ihtiyaç ve beceri seviyelerine hitap etmektedir. İyi bir seçim, sadece www.bahsegel.com mekaniği değil, aynı zamanda topluluk desteği, dokümantasyon ve güncellemelerin sıklığı gibi faktörleri de dikkate almalıdır.
Geliştiricilerin, motorun sunduğu özellikler ile projenin gereksinimlerini dengelemeleri önemlidir. Grafik kalitesi, fizik simülasyonu ve ağ desteği gibi unsurlar, kullanılacak aracı belirlerken göz önünde bulundurulmalıdır.
Son olarak, seçilen motorun kullanıcı dostu arayüzü ve öğrenme eğrisi de kritik bir rol oynar. Yeni başlayanlar için kolaylık sağlarken, deneyimli geliştiricilerin de daha karmaşık projeleri hızlıca hayata geçirmelerine olanak tanımalıdır.
Performans Optimizasyonu
Yüksek verimlilik, kullanıcı deneyimini doğrudan etkileyen kritik bir unsurdur. Uygulamaların hızlı ve akıcı çalışması, hem kullanıcı memnuniyetini artırır hem de genel etkileşimi güçlendirir. Bu bağlamda, çeşitli yöntemlerle performansın artırılması, geliştiricilerin odaklanması gereken önemli bir konudur.
Performansı artırmak için uygulamanızda dikkate almanız gereken bazı temel unsurlar bulunmaktadır. Aşağıda, bu unsurları daha iyi anlamanıza yardımcı olacak bir tablo sunulmuştur:
| Kaynak Yönetimi | Gereksiz dosyaları ve kodları kaldırarak hafıza kullanımını optimize edin. |
| Asenkron Yükleme | Veri ve kaynakları asenkron olarak yükleyerek sayfa geçişlerini hızlandırın. |
| Önbellekleme | Sık kullanılan verileri önbelleğe alarak erişim sürelerini kısaltın. |
| Resim Optimizasyonu | Görüntü boyutlarını küçültün ve uygun formatlar kullanın. |
| Veritabanı İyileştirmesi | Sorguları optimize ederek veri erişim hızını artırın. |
Bu yöntemler, uygulamanızın performansını artırmak için etkili araçlardır. Her birini dikkatlice uygulamak, daha hızlı ve etkili bir deneyim sunmanıza yardımcı olacaktır.
Kullanıcı Deneyimi Odaklı Tasarım
Kullanıcı deneyimi, bir ürün veya hizmetin etkileşimini ve kullanıcıların bu süreçte hissettiklerini belirleyen önemli bir unsurdur. Başarılı bir tasarım, kullanıcıların ihtiyaçlarını anlayarak ve onlara kolaylık sağlayarak oluşturulmalıdır. Kullanıcıların duygusal bağ kurmasını sağlayan, sezgisel ve akıcı bir deneyim sunmak, hedef kitleye ulaşmanın temel yoludur.
Öncelikle, kullanıcıların neyi aradığını ve nasıl hareket ettiğini analiz etmek, tasarım sürecinin temelini oluşturur. Kullanıcı araştırmaları ve geri bildirimler, tasarımcıların kararlarını yönlendiren değerli veriler sunar. Prototiplerin test edilmesi, kullanıcıların deneyimlerini gözlemleyerek tasarımın geliştirilmesine olanak tanır.
Ayrıca, kullanıcı arayüzünün sade ve anlaşılır olması, kullanıcıların rahatlıkla gezinebilmesini sağlar. Her bir buton, menü veya etkileşim öğesi, kullanıcıların beklentilerine uygun bir şekilde tasarlanmalıdır. Hızlı yükleme süreleri ve mobil uyumluluk, kullanıcıların deneyimini olumlu yönde etkileyen diğer kritik unsurlardır.
Sonuç olarak, kullanıcı deneyimine odaklanan bir tasarım yaklaşımı, yalnızca estetik değil, aynı zamanda işlevsel bir ürün ortaya çıkartır. Bu süreçte kullanıcıların geri bildirimlerini dikkate almak, tasarımın sürekli olarak gelişmesine katkıda bulunur.
Güvenlik İpuçları
Bu bölümde, çevrimiçi platformlarda karşılaşılabilecek tehditlere karşı korunmanın yollarını ele alacağız. Kullanıcıların ve sistemlerin güvenliğini artırmak için benimsenmesi gereken pratik adımlar, potansiyel riskleri en aza indirmek için hayati öneme sahiptir.
Güçlü Parolalar Oluşturun: Her hesap için benzersiz ve karmaşık şifreler kullanmak, yetkisiz erişimi önlemenin temel yollarından biridir. Parola yöneticileri, farklı şifreleri hatırlamanızı kolaylaştırabilir.
İki Aşamalı Kimlik Doğrulama: Bu ek güvenlik katmanı, hesabınıza giriş yaparken ekstra bir doğrulama gerektirir. SMS veya uygulama üzerinden alınan bir kod, potansiyel saldırganların işini zorlaştırır.
Güncellemeleri İhmal Etmeyin: Yazılım ve platform güncellemelerini düzenli olarak yapmak, bilinen açıkların kapatılmasını sağlar. Eski sürümler, siber saldırganlar için hedef haline gelebilir.
Şüpheli Bağlantılardan Kaçının: E-postalarda veya sosyal medyada karşınıza çıkan tanımadığınız bağlantılara tıklamaktan kaçının. Bu tür bağlantılar, kötü niyetli yazılımlara veya oltalama saldırılarına yol açabilir.
Veri Şifreleme: Hassas bilgilerinizi korumak için şifreleme yöntemlerini kullanın. Bu, verilerinizi izinsiz erişimden korumanıza yardımcı olur.
Güvenlik Duvarı Kullanımı: Bir güvenlik duvarı, gelen ve giden trafiği kontrol ederek zararlı yazılımların sisteminize girmesini engelleyebilir. Bu tür araçlar, çevrimiçi güvenliğinizi artırır.
Farkındalık Eğitimi: Kullanıcıların siber tehditler hakkında bilgi sahibi olması, riskleri azaltmak için önemlidir. Bilinçli kullanıcılar, olası tehlikelere karşı daha hazırlıklı olurlar.